Q: How is AC maintenance different from a repair call in Mountain Home?A: Maintenance is proactive — it finds problems before they cause failures. A repair call in Mountain Home means something already stopped working. Maintenance prevents the repair call.
Q: How often should I schedule AC maintenance in Mountain Home?A: Once a year minimum. Twice yearly for systems in high-demand or long cooling-season climates like Mountain Home.

Idaho's Snake River Plain summers hit 100°F+ with dry heat that stresses AC components differently than humid climates — capacitor failure from intense heat load and refrigerant loss from thermal expansion and contraction after cold winters are the two most common issues Mountain Home homeowners face. Central AC adoption in Idaho has grown rapidly over the last decade, and many systems are running without their first major service.
